Understanding American Cockroaches

American cockroaches are notorious for invading homes. They are attracted to warmth, moisture, and food sources. These pests can easily find their way inside if there are openings, such as damaged vent screens. It is essential to seal any gaps to prevent these pests from entering.

How Damage Occurs

Damage to vent screens can happen due to various reasons. Here are some common causes:

  • Weather-related wear and tear
  • Improper installation
  • Physical damage from outdoor debris

Prevention Tips from Professionals

To keep cockroaches at bay, consider these preventive measures:

  • Regularly inspect vent screens for damage
  • Seal any gaps or openings
  • Maintain cleanliness in and around your home
